I love to mix up products to see how they work. I took some old body splashes the other day and came up with a pretty great scent. I took creamy coconut, tangerine spice, and warm vanilla sugar together to make a nice new splash. It actually smelled really good. I also like to take my Benefit Body So Fine Puff and use what is left on my hair to make it shiny (when it is dry) The Sephora web site suggested that a little while back and it really does work. I could not believe it.

 
I mix up the last of body lotions, creams, serums & sunscreens for a delux brew. I cut open squeeze tubes & scrape out at least 1-2 ounces witih a spatula & if it's too think, I add cooled green tea, lemon juice, vit. C cystals or powder & vit. E oil.
